Physical description
Capybaras live in areas with water nearby so they have many features that help them survive on land and water.
A Capybara has long and brittle fur that is easy to dry in the sun when it comes out of the water. The capybara is the biggest living rodent It weighs 35-65 kg. Capybaras are mammals and can hold their breath for Eight minutes! They have partially webbed toes which also help them when diving to the bottom of the water.

Eating/food
Capybaras eat plants because they are herbivores.they get there food from forest and eat plants in the water. Capybara eat their own poop because it contains beneficial bacteria that helps their stomach to break down the fiber from the grass.capybara need to be careful when they are looking for food or they will become the food.
